| cd-4 percentage Oct 8, 2005 I've been positive for a little over 2 years and I still don't know what it means when the nurse says that my cd-4 percentage went up. Can you explain what exactly this percentage means and what it is based on? Thank you, B. |
||||||||||
|
|
Response from Dr. Holodniy
You really need to go and get all your numbers. You should have this information on hand, not only for yourself, but if you need to see other doctors. The CD4 count is usually expressed as an absolute number and a percentage of total t lymphocytes. | |||||||||
